Середня зарплата Разработчик в Україні Статистика зарплат Разработчик в Україна.

Posted by admin

Большинство учебных центров и образовательных компаний в IT-сфере дают определенные знания, но не заботятся о человеке. Наша задача – заботиться о том, что он трудоустроится, будет нужен рынку, получит необходимые навыки, сможет пройти цикл обучения с нуля и стать полноценным джуниором. Мы помогаем нашим студентам не только получить знания и навыки, но и работу. CMO IT Education Academy Николай Гугули рассказал читателям Enguide о том, зачем IT-специалистам нужен английский и каких разработчиков ищут крупнейшие компании-работодатели. Основы веб-дизайна от Креативної практики — видеокурс для новичков в веб-дизайне, содержит и теорию, и практику. Учат разбираться в анатомии сайтов, адаптивности и кроссбраузерности, принципам удобства.

Frontend разработчик как им стать

Есть проекты, где очень сложный бэкенд и на этих проектах предпочитают выделенных бэкендеров, им знания фронта обычно не нужны. На таких проектах либо дополнительно берут фулстек-разработчика, чтобы он мог поправить фронт, либо же нанимают отдельного фронтендера. А есть большие проекты, но не с супер сложным бэккендом и фронтендом. Для таких проектов очень выгодно брать full stack разработчиков, которые немного (на достаточном уровне) разбираются в бэке, и немного разбираются во фронте.

Frontend разработчик пишет код для внешней части сайта. Работа специалиста – не просто верстка, а более глобальные задачи. Умение слушать людей и прислушиваться к чужому мнению поможет вам продвинуться на пути разработчика. Более опытные коллеги дадут необходимую информацию быстрее и компактнее, нежели если бы вы учили ее самостоятельно. При этом также важно уметь формировать свое мнение и отстаивать его. Качество вашего кода должно улучшаться, а количество комментариев уменьшаться.

Мы заменили Redux на Apollo, и все работает отлично. Как бонус всегда актуальна документация для ваших запросов. Часть работы https://deveducation.com/ Front-end разработчик передали дизайнеру, а именно часть верстки. Инструменты Figma и ей подобные генерируют CSS компоненты.

Кто такой Full Stack разработчик и как им стать

Мы действительно помогаем нашим студентам не только получить знания и навыки, но и работу. Все преподаватели – практики, многие из них – работающие непосредственно в этой сфере люди, которые преподают по вечерам. У нас также огромное количество спикеров, которые являются профессионалами своего дела. Front-end, веб-дизайн, тестирование от Logos IT academy (100 бесплатных мест) — курсы по IT-направлениям стартуют с середины апреля, проходят онлайн. Зачисление производится на основе двух этапов отбора. Основы тестирования ПО от QA TestLab — курс для всех желающих получить опыт в области тестирования.

Такая необходимость разграничения вызвана разными зонами ответственности в том или ином проекте. Простыми словами, бэкенд работает над программно-аппаратной стороной (“задней”), а фронтенд специалист разрабатывает публичный интерфейс, который видим мы как юзеры. Профессия Front end верстальщика позволяет работать как https://deveducation.com/blog/chto-dolzhen-ymet-frontend-razrabotchik/ в офисе, так и удаленно. Вы сможете создавать конкурентные веб-сайты на заказ по макету дизайнера или без него, работая на себя или устроившись в IT агентство. Кроме того, верстальщики бывают востребованы в типографиях и компаниях, которые занимаются переводами. В последнем случае вы также можете работать удаленно.

Какие специалисты нужны IT-рынку сейчас?

Вы получите очень большое преимущество, если найдёте себе FrontEnd-ментора. С таким раскладом изучать FrontEnd с нуля станет гораздо легче и продуктивнее. Это основные инструменты современного FrontEnd разработчика.

Frontend разработчик как им стать

Для упрощения работы мы используем разные библиотеки, языки программирования (например, TypeScript), множество ресурсов (изображения, шрифты). Чтобы все это оптимально собрать и создать оптимизированный билд проекта, мы и используем Webpack. Созданные нами проекты нужно где хранить, чтобы можно было делиться исходным кодом, смотреть, когда мы это создавали и как меняли. Git – идеальное решение, ведь это самая популярная система контроля версий. Важно заметить, что темы из этого списка не нужно учить все сразу.

И последний вопрос – о гендерном распределении. Много ли девушек сейчас идут в IT?

Front-End имеет отношение к клиентской части приложения, ее видит пользователь и с ней он непосредственно взаимодействует. Back-End имеет отношение к серверной части приложения. Обычно сюда входят логические процессы; процессы, связанные с базой данных; проверка пользователей; конфигурация сервера. Далее мы разберем подробнее, как стать Full-Stack разработчиком. Не нужно углубляться в алгоритм и структуру данных, знать «на отлично» математику. Эта отрасль IT-индустрии достаточно снисходительна к новичкам.

  • Эти классы имеют множество настроек из коробки, что избавляет программиста от необходимости делать всё с нуля.
  • Это основные инструменты современного FrontEnd разработчика.
  • В портфолио должно быть несколько сильных проектов, в которых продемонстрированы все навыки, которыми владеете на момент поиска вакансии.
  • React ориентирован на функциональное создание компонентов, предоставляет разработчику большое количество плагинов, позволяющих построить любой веб-сайт.
  • Business Analysis Essentials от e5 — бесплатный видеокурс для тех, кто хочет начать карьеру бизнес-аналитика.

Таким образом, разработчик может работать один, без команды и трудоустройства в компанию. Из-за войны большое количество специалистов в IT и других сферах потеряли работу. Особенно сложно найти позицию свитчерам, Trainee и Junior с небольшим опытом. Поэтому мы решили собрать список бесплатных курсов, вебинаров и приложений, которые помогут улучшить знания в различных сферах, чтобы получить такой необходимый job offer. Back-End-прграммирование предполагает изучение хотя бы одного языка, применяемого для кодирования процессов, происходящих на сервере.

Кто такой Front End разработчик и чем он занимается?

QA Automation и Data Engineering от Parimatch Tech Academy — два курса от компании Parimatch, на которых предусмотрены практические задания, проект и оплачиваемая стажировка. Заявки принимаются до 21 сентября (продолжительность 3,5 месяца). Software Engineering School 3.0 — курс для junior- и middle-разработчиков от компании Genesis и Киево-Могилянской академии. На курсе рассказывают о построении “чистой архитектуры”, контеризации, виртуализации и этапах SDLC. С Романом Шмелевым, ментором и координатором школы программирования Ш++, разобрались в том, как выбрать язык программирования и прокачать hard skills, если вы новичок в IT.

Курсы по фронтенду: как получить профессию мечты

Если делать неоправданно большие перерывы, уменьшать время на занятия, прокрастинировать и тому подобное, желаемый финиш вы можете увидеть через год-два, а то и вовсе бросите учёбу. Первый вариант принесёт успех только при наличии большой самодисциплинированности, ведь вы подотчётны только себе. Такой вариант подойдёт тем, кто действительно горит программированием, влюблён во фронтенд-стихию и имеет достаточный запас временного ресурса для обучения. Большое количество практики — то, что нужно любому разработчику, изучающему FrontEnd с нуля. Практика позволяет лучше понять и усвоить изученный материал, а также способствует развитию ваших навыков написания кода.

FrontEnd

Блог или интернет-магазин можно сделать через час. А функционала там будет столько, что самому за всю жизнь столько не написать. Данных знаний и технологий уже достаточно для создания полноценных сайтов-визиток, лендингов и других простых сайтов на несколько страниц.

С чего начать изучение фронтенда

Чтобы стать профессиональным front-end разработчиком, вам понадобится углубиться в HTML, CSS и client-side JavaScript (компоненты на стороне пользователя). Вам также понадобится разобраться в кое-каких важных фреймворках. Так вы обзаведетесь навыками, которые клиенты и работодатели хотят видеть у front-end разработчиков. Эти платформы позволяют свести к минимуму лишние операции и сформировать мгновенный обмен данными с сервером.